Description

This Release of Lien form is for use by an individual lienor to waive, release, and quit claim all liens, lien rights, claims or demands of every kind whatsoever, including his or her claim of lien against certain real estate and improvements on account of work and labor performed, and/or materials furnished in improving the property.

In Florida, a construction lien generally lasts for one year from the date it was recorded. However, it is crucial to be aware that this timeframe can be shortened if the lien holder does not file a lawsuit to enforce the lien within this period.
